Verdict

Providence and Warwick are closely matched on overall diagnostic medical sonographer compensation, each winning on different metrics.

The salary gap between Providence and Warwick is $1,999 (2.03%). Warwick's median is -0.77% compared to the US national median of $101,352.

Salary Range Comparison

The full salary range (10th to 90th percentile) in Providence spans $47,670,Warwick spans $65,270. Warwick has a wider pay range, suggesting more variation in pay between entry-level and experienced diagnostic medical sonographers.

Cost-of-Living Adjusted Comparison

After cost-of-living adjustment, Warwick ($100,070 effective) pays 3.32% more than Providence ($96,854 effective).

Historical Salary Growth Comparison

Based on BLS OEWS metropolitan area data, diagnostic medical sonographer salaries in Providence grew 7.8% from 2019 to 2025, compared to 4.9% growth in Warwick over the same period.
